linuxtar解压所有文件命令

worktile 其他 53

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ux中,使用tar命令来解压文件是非常常见的操作。tar命令是一个综合性的文件打包和压缩命令,可以将多个文件或目录打包成一个文件,并可以对该文件进行压缩。

    要解压tar文件中的所有文件,可以使用以下命令:

    “`shell
    tar -xvf filename.tar
    “`

    其中,`filename.tar`为你要解压的tar文件的名称。这个命令中的选项含义如下:
    – `-x`:表示解压文件
    – `-v`:表示显示详细的解压过程,可以看到每个文件的解压进度
    – `-f`:后面跟着需要解压的文件名

    执行上述命令后,tar文件将会被解压到当前目录下。

    如果tar文件中有多个文件夹,并且你只想解压其中的某个文件夹,可以使用以下命令:

    “`shell
    tar -xvf filename.tar foldername
    “`

    其中,`foldername`为你要解压的文件夹的名称。执行该命令后,只有该文件夹会被解压到当前目录下。

    如果tar文件被压缩成了gzip格式(后缀为`.tar.gz`或`.tgz`),则可以使用以下命令解压:

    “`shell
    tar -xzvf filename.tar.gz
    “`

    如果tar文件被压缩成了bzip2格式(后缀为`.tar.bz2`或`.tbz2`),则可以使用以下命令解压:

    “`shell
    tar -xjvf filename.tar.bz2
    “`

    以上就是解压tar文件的命令。根据不同的压缩格式,可以选择不同的命令参数来解压文件。希望对你有帮助!

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ux上,使用tar命令可以用来解压tar压缩文件。下面是解压各种类型的tar文件的命令:

    1. 解压.tar文件:
    “`
    tar -xvf file.tar
    “`

    2. 解压.tar.gz文件:
    “`
    tar -xzvf file.tar.gz
    “`

    3. 解压.tar.bz2文件:
    “`
    tar -xjvf file.tar.bz2
    “`

    4. 解压.tar.xz文件:
    “`
    tar -xJvf file.tar.xz
    “`

    5. 解压.tar.Z文件:
    “`
    tar -xZvf file.tar.Z
    “`

    6. 解压.tar.lz文件:
    “`
    tar –lzip -xvf file.tar.lz
    “`

    7. 解压.tar.lzo文件:
    “`
    tar –lzop -xvf file.tar.lzo
    “`

    8. 解压.tar.lzma文件:
    “`
    tar –lzma -xvf file.tar.lzma
    “`

    9. 解压.tar.zst文件:
    “`
    tar –zstd -xvf file.tar.zst
    “`

    在上面的命令中,选项解释如下:
    – `-x`:解压文件
    – `-v`:显示详细输出
    – `-f`:指定压缩文件的名称

    使用这些命令,你可以轻松地解压各种类型的tar压缩文件在Linux系统上。请确保你已经正确安装了tar软件包。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用tar命令进行文件压缩和解压缩。想要解压所有文件,可以使用以下命令:

    1. 解压tar文件:tar -xvf filename.tar
    命令说明:
    – -x:表示解压缩操作
    – -v:显示详细的解压缩过程
    – -f:指定要解压缩的文件名

    2. 解压tar.gz文件:tar -xzvf filename.tar.gz
    命令说明:
    – -z:表示使用gzip压缩算法
    – -x:表示解压缩操作
    – -v:显示详细的解压缩过程
    – -f:指定要解压缩的文件名

    3. 解压tar.bz2文件:tar -xjvf filename.tar.bz2
    命令说明:
    – -j:表示使用bzip2压缩算法
    – -x:表示解压缩操作
    – -v:显示详细的解压缩过程
    – -f:指定要解压缩的文件名

    4. 解压tar.xz文件:tar -xJvf filename.tar.xz
    命令说明:
    – -J:表示使用xz压缩算法
    – -x:表示解压缩操作
    – -v:显示详细的解压缩过程
    – -f:指定要解压缩的文件名

    需要注意的是,在解压缩文件时,要确保目标文件夹的读写权限。解压后的文件会被存放在当前目录或指定的目录中。

    另外,如果想要解压tar文件中的指定文件,可以使用以下命令:
    tar -xvf filename.tar path/to/file
    其中,path/to/file是要解压的文件的路径。

    如果要解压缩到指定的目录,可以使用以下命令:
    tar -xvf filename.tar -C /path/to/directory
    其中,/path/to/directory是要解压到的目录路径。

    以上是在命令行中使用tar命令进行文件解压的方法。使用这些命令,可以轻松地解压缩tar、tar.gz、tar.bz2以及tar.xz等不同格式的压缩文件,并且可以指定解压到的目录。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部